Up 4 in 3rd, Chicago needs OT to beat LA (AP)

Patrick Sharp scored his second goal of the game 1:48 into overtime and the Chicago Blackhawks beat the Los Angeles Kings 6-5 on Saturday after blowing a four-goal lead in the third period. The Blackhawks built a 5-1 lead in the second period with four goals in a 4:06 span.
